Output ec0508ada880e9e6e70a8570ad17c737ecd936a8390242859ad1d010dc04deda:16

value
348645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9278f160185165a9ea76512b37fc952c96565e OP_EQUAL
address
3Bb6NLwB5rE8vBM6JRy9XE3CBTMyfYLuZ4
transaction
ec0508ada880e9e6e70a8570ad17c737ecd936a8390242859ad1d010dc04deda